Organic Music Society
by Don Cherry
Recorded in 1972, Don Cherry's 'Organic Music Society' is a seminal work of free jazz exploration. Its sound is improvisational and experimental, reflecting a spirit of uninhibited musical inquiry. The album's unique character arises from the interaction of diverse musical ideas and textures, creating a listening experience that is both challenging and rewarding.
